五轴编程,顾名思义,是指对五轴联动数控机床进行编程的过程。这种机床在航空航天、汽车制造、模具加工等领域有着广泛的应用。对于想要学习五轴编程的新手来说,了解一些入门技巧至关重要。本文将为您详细解析从新手到高手的编程技巧。
一、五轴编程基础知识
1. 五轴联动数控机床概述
五轴联动数控机床是指具有五个自由度的数控机床,包括三个线性轴(X、Y、Z轴)和两个旋转轴(A、B轴)。这种机床能够实现工件在三维空间内的任意方向加工,大大提高了加工精度和效率。
2. 五轴编程软件
常见的五轴编程软件有Mastercam、Cimatron、Siemens NX等。这些软件具有丰富的功能和强大的加工能力,能够满足不同领域的加工需求。
二、五轴编程入门技巧
1. 熟悉编程软件界面
在开始编程之前,首先要熟悉编程软件的界面和功能。了解各个工具栏、菜单栏和对话框的作用,以便在编程过程中能够快速找到所需的功能。
2. 学习基本编程命令
五轴编程的基本命令包括直线、圆弧、螺旋线等。掌握这些基本命令是进行复杂编程的基础。
3. 理解机床结构
了解机床的结构和运动方式对于编写正确的程序至关重要。熟悉各个轴的运动范围和限制,有助于避免编程错误。
4. 练习编程技巧
通过实际操作练习编程技巧,如路径优化、加工参数设置等。以下是一些实用的编程技巧:
a. 路径优化
在编程过程中,应尽量使刀具路径短、平滑,以减少加工时间和提高加工质量。
b. 加工参数设置
根据工件材料和加工要求,合理设置加工参数,如切削速度、进给量、切削深度等。
c. 避免碰撞
在编程过程中,要确保刀具路径不会与机床结构发生碰撞,以免损坏机床或工件。
三、五轴编程进阶技巧
1. 复杂曲面加工
对于复杂曲面加工,需要掌握一些高级编程技巧,如曲面拟合、曲面分割等。
2. 仿真与验证
在编程完成后,应对程序进行仿真和验证,以确保加工效果符合预期。
3. 编程经验积累
随着编程经验的积累,可以尝试编写更复杂的程序,提高自己的编程水平。
四、总结
五轴编程是一门技术性较强的领域,需要不断学习和实践。通过本文的介绍,相信您已经对五轴编程有了初步的了解。只要掌握好入门技巧,不断积累经验,您一定能够成为一名优秀的五轴编程高手。祝您学习顺利!
